Scroll of the Contemporary Word | The NIV Bible

The New International Version (NIV) Bible is the bridge between ancient truth and modern tongue. First published in 1978, it sought to make Scripture accessible to a global audience without sacrificing depth. The NIV speaks in clarity, in a language for today, yet it holds the weight of eternity in every word.


🌿 The Mission of the NIV

  • Translation Philosophy: A dynamic equivalence approach—faithful to original texts yet fluid in contemporary English, designed for readability and understanding.
  • Global Collaboration: Over 100 scholars from diverse Christian traditions, working together to create a Bible that bridges denominations and nations.
  • Impact: As of 2023, the NIV remains one of the most popular and widely used English Bible translations in the world, embraced in churches, schools, and personal study.
